Transaction 77063f284bce50067af9f536626771ad27da2624d8120e73e77cf24e21bf4756
1 Input
1 Output
-
77063f284bce50067af9f536626771ad27da2624d8120e73e77cf24e21bf4756:0
- value
- 510567
- script pubkey
- OP_0 OP_PUSHBYTES_20 4f0c4382ef093c89257730364a38431aca21fc4c
- address
- bc1qfuxy8qh0py7gjfthxqmy5wzrrt9zrlzvzjvyg6